About Amy

Amy Rodriguez is a Licensed Clinical Social Worker (LCSW) based in Connecticut with 11 years of professional experience helping adults navigate stress, anxiety, trauma and abuse, depression, and challenges with self-esteem and motivation. She approaches each person with respect, sensitivity, and compassion, and she emphasizes tailoring conversations and treatment plans to reflect each individual’s circumstances and goals.

Amy works with people facing life transitions, relationship and communication difficulties, feelings of isolation or loneliness, and workplace or women's issues. Her practice focuses on building confidence, improving coping skills, and supporting recovery from post-traumatic stress and other trauma-related concerns. She offers guidance aimed at practical change and personal growth while honoring each client’s pace and preferences.

Recognizing that seeking help takes courage, Amy supports clients through the early steps of change and throughout the therapeutic process. She collaborates with people to develop realistic strategies for managing symptoms and strengthening self-love and resilience, helping them move toward a more fulfilling and balanced life.

Evidence-Based Approaches and Flexible Online Care



Amy Rodriguez uses evidence-based therapeutic techniques tailored to address stress and anxiety by teaching practical coping skills and emotion management strategies that help reduce overwhelm and improve daily functioning. She applies trauma-informed methods to support recovery from trauma and abuse, focusing on safety, stabilization, and gradual processing of difficult experiences to restore a sense of control and resilience. She also offers work focused on building self-esteem and motivation, helping clients identify strengths, challenge negative self-beliefs, and develop sustainable habits for confidence and self-love.

Finding the right approach is part of the therapy process, and Amy collaborates with each person to determine which techniques best match their needs, goals, and preferences. She adjusts treatment plans over time and invites client feedback so the work remains relevant and effective.
